Case Study · Major healthcare organisation
Application Management Services (AMS) support for an already-implemented healthcare ERP used by more than 200 concurrent users, with patient medical records and financial details on a centralized server. An offsite AMS team with a 24×7 help desk delivered detailed root-cause and performance analysis, performance tuning, hotfixes and continuous improvement, plus customized modifications and upgrades. The engagement improved third-party reporting (insurance, corporate clients and Government departments such as MA Yojna), defined backup and cloud-solution strategies, and cut technical issues and data disputes.

A robust grid-based image-stitching algorithm for microscopic images, deployed on Android and desktop. An automated microscope generates a grid of partially overlapping tiles, and the algorithm matches features between neighbours — regardless of rotation, scaling or translation — assembling hundreds of tiles into a single mosaic using a Minimum Spanning Tree.
